Description
Bangladesh is one of the high-risk countries of the COVID-19 pandemic and its consequent losses. The main objectives of this research were to find out the livelihood challenges and coping strategies of agricultural workers during pandemic situation. This study was conducted targeting lower income group of people (temporary agricultural worker, casual agricultural workers). As the nature of the research was qualitative, the researcher used convenience sampling to select respondents because this is the most common non-probability sampling strategy where respondents were selected in an ad hoc fashion based on their accessibility. However, the researcher has taken 60 respondents as sample in analyzing data, descriptive statistics (frequency and percentage) of responses are estimated. Scores of livelihood challenges are the means of a 4-point Likert-type scale used. From this study find that most of the respondents did small business but they did not get any help or small loan from NGO. Most of the respondents drive rickshaw, auto as their off day. Due to closing of school, respondents’ children engage themselves to earning activities.
